Sentara Laboratory Services Promotes Jeans for Babies

On June 29, the staff of Sentara Laboratory Services will sponsor "Blue Jeans for Babies Day" to benefit the March of Dimes.

For $2 per BJFB sticker or $3 for a collectable BJFB pin, staff members at seven Sentara hospital campuses throughout Hampton Roads can enjoy wearing jeans and also help the March of Dimes.

This is a timely example of Sentara leading the way in healthcare.  In Gov. Tim Kaine’s State of the Commonwealth address, he stated: "One of our most glaring health failures is our infant morality rate. Today, Virginia's infant mortality rate is 32nd in the nation...... There is no excuse for a state with one of the highest incomes in the nation to have so many babies die in their first year of life."

In April Gov. Kaine targeted 10 Cities in Virginia for an immediate action plan to address the prematurity crises.  Norfolk, Virginia Beach, Chesapeake, Portsmouth and Newport News were on the list.
 
Advocacy, mission awareness and education are major steps in helping overcome the problem of babies born too soon.

Laboratory staff at Sentara Norfolk General, Sentara Virginia Beach General, Sentara Leigh, Sentara Bayside and Sentara Princess Anne, Sentara Careplex, Port Warwick II and Sentara Williamsburg Regional Medical Center will be selling labels and badges to their colleagues during the last two weeks of June. 

Sentara Laboratory Services, a division of Sentara Healthcare, is Hampton Roads’ only full-service reference laboratory.  Sentara Laboratory Services employs approximately 600 staff throughout Hampton
Roads, operates a network of conveniently located draw sites and performs more than six million tests each year using the most advanced procedures and state of the art equipment.  For more information about Sentara Laboratory Services, visit http://www.sentara.com/lab.
